Baba Haridass College of Pharmacy and Technology, Delhi Admission Process
Baba Haridass College of Pharmacy and Technology, New Delhi, is a prestigious institution that specializes in pharmaceutical education. The college located in Jharoda Kalan, New Delhi, offers diploma programs in pharmacy and medical laboratory technology. The focus of the institute is to provide high-quality education pertaining to the pharmaceutical field; hence, it is recognized for its PCI-approved pharmacy programs and AICTE-approved MBA program.
The admission procedure at Baba Haridass College of Pharmacy and Technology is based on merit and considers the performance of candidates in certain subjects on admission tests, creating a more focused learning environment for prospective pharmacists and medical laboratory technicians. Academic performance in relevant subjects is thus a pivotal factor during the admission process. Candidates are assessed based on their performance in admission tests designed to evaluate their knowledge and aptitude for the subject of their choice.
Application Process
The admission processes for Baba Haridass College of Pharmacy and Technology comprise the following:
1. Announcement of Admissions: The college announces the commencement of the admission process through its official website and other media channels. Prospective students are advised to visit the college website for news release about date and procedure on admission.
2. Application Form: The candidates are to obtain and fill the college admission application form. No details about application forms being made available are so far given-probably available either at the college website or at the college campus.
3. Document Submission: Absolutely necessary documents must accompany the filled-in application form, these generally include:
- 10th and 12th standard mark-sheets
- Proof of date of birth
- Category certificate (if applicable)
- Recent passport-size photographs
- Any other documents mentioned by the college.
4. Entrance Test: Candidates may be required to appear for an entrance test conducted by the college, to assess applicants' knowledge in relevant subjects for the course applied for.
5. Merit List Preparation: A merit list of eligible candidates is prepared based on the performance of the candidates in the entrance test conducted by the college and in their academic records.
6. Counselling and Admission: Candidates on the merit list will be called for counseling, where they choose courses according to their own merit ranks.
7. Fee Payment: Chosen candidates shall pay the requisite fees to secure the admission.
8. Document verification: Following this, the college shall carry out thorough verification of all documents before confirming the admission.
Degree wise Admission Process
D. Pharma: The D. Pharma course at Baba Haridass College of Pharmacy and Technology is a full-time diploma course created in view of the growing demands of the pharmaceutical industry. There are 60 seats in the approved intake. Admission into the D. Pharma course is done on merit consideration of the performance of the candidate in relevant subjects during the admission test. This is usually for those completing their 10+2 with sciences, which basically should be Physics, Chemistry, and Biology/Mathematics.
Diploma in Medical Laboratory Technology (DMLT): The DMLT programme found in the same college is also a full-time diploma course that caters to the needs of the health care sector. DMLT has the same approved number of intake as D. Pharma, which is 60 seats. The admission process for DMLT is merit-based and evaluates candidates' performances in specific subjects in the admission test. This program usually requires eligibility for students completing 10+2 with science subjects, most importantly with Biology.
The two programs intend to give students theoretical and practical knowledge with great importance in their respective fields. Having the advantage of modern laboratories and facilities, the college is committed to giving students a very practical learning experience that supports classroom knowledge.
Diploma in Pharmacy (D.Pharma) is a two-year full-time diploma course offered by the Directorate of Training and Technical Education, New Delhi , and approved by All India Council for Technical Education (AICTE) and Pharmacy Council of India (PCI).
Eligibility Criteria :
You must have passed 10th Std./ SSC examination and have obtained at least 35% marks in the qualifying examination from a recognised Institute.
Admission Process :
The Admission to the Diploma Courses are based on a Common Entrance Test (CET) conducted by the Department of Training and Technical Education (DTTE) , Delhi held tentatively in the month of May/June every year.
